Sebastian Vettel joined the group of critics who would like to see 4-cylinder turbocharged engines and the Kinetic Energy Recovery System (KERS) outside Formula 1 in the future. According to the reigning world champion, the best thing the FIA could do in the next few years would be to switch to even more powerful units, most preferred V12s.

I would put a V12 engine in the car - (I'm) against all the four-cylinder advocacy, said the 23-year old German driver in a recent interview with Formula ...
